I live in MN and ive done something similar to this for the last 3 years...I used the same foil insulation around with added layers of bubble wrap, I used foam insulation board to make the housing around the pump, I also use a pool solar cover on top of the water/below the cover.

Thank you for the video! I had the same problem, intermittent puddle of water on the left front of the fridge. I knew it wasn't the ice maker since I turn the ice maker off for 48 hours. I used a long thin plastic zip tie, about 12", to unclog the drain pipe in the back of the freezer. Thank you again!

With this model, you basically push up on the glass, which releases it from the catches on the frame. Then pull straight out.To replace, push the glass back in (keep it level) and then let it drop back down into plce
